Pick the Top Surface Materials for Your Undertaking
Which strategies help property owners determine the optimal paving materials for their work? Getting the material correct is necessary for aesthetics and how it performs.
First, property owners should think about the particular purpose of the paved area. For driveways, durable materials like asphalt or concrete are often preferred due to their strength and longevity. In contrast, for patios or walkways, choices like pavers or bricks can offer aesthetic value and flexibility.
Next, climate acts as a significant component. Locales with heavy rainfall may benefit from permeable materials that allow for better drainage, reducing the risk of deluge.
Also, maintenance requirements should be reviewed; some materials require more care than others.
Finally, budget limitations will determine the choice. While high-grade materials may involve a significant initial expense, they commonly provide long-term financial benefits through durability and lower repair expenses.
As a result, detailed examination of these considerations will help property owners in making informed choices.

Starting Site Survey
Which factors impact the preliminary site evaluation for paving installation? Several vital points come into play during this important stage. First, the land’s topography is examined to detect any slopes or drainage problems that may impact the paving process. Then, the current soil conditions are reviewed, as different soil types can affect stability and durability. Also, site accessibility is taken into account to determine how equipment and materials will be delivered. Local regulations and zoning laws are reviewed to guarantee compliance. Finally, existing structures and vegetation are evaluated to plan for any necessary removal or protection. This thorough evaluation provides the basis for a successful paving project, ensuring that all possible challenges are managed from the beginning.
Setup Processes Presented
Once a complete site review is completed, the paving installation process can start.
The preliminary stage encompasses location preparation, where any pre-existing debris are eliminated and the ground is made level. Next, a base layer is applied, typically containing gravel or pulverized stone, which delivers stability and drainage.
Following this, the determined paving material—such as asphalt or concrete—is positioned. This phase involves thorough attention to guarantee a smooth finish and proper alignment.
Once the paving is in place, it is compacted to enhance durability. Finally, curing takes place, allowing the material to harden properly.
Throughout the process, clear dialogue with the property owner is essential to resolve any issues and assure contentment with the final result.
Pavement Preservation Strategies for Lasting Durability
While asphalt areas are designed for durability, ongoing care remains important to guarantee their lasting value. Routine inspections should be carried out to spot surface damage, holes, or deterioration. Swift repairs can prevent further damage and increase the lifespan of the asphalt.
In addition, keeping the surface tidy is essential; debris, leaves, and dirt can capture moisture, resulting in deterioration. Regular sweeping and intermittent power washing aid sustain a spotless appearance and effectiveness.
Applying sealant every few years can preserve the surface from climate exposure and UV radiation, while also improving its aesthetic appeal.
Finally, addressing drainage problems is significant. Adequate drainage systems prevent water buildup, which can deteriorate the paving material over time.

Questions That Are Frequently Asked
How long Will a Typical Paving Project Take to Finish?
A typical paving job generally requires one to three days to finish, based on factors such as the project's size, complexity, climate, and preparation requirements. Effective planning can help streamline the process effectively.
What Licenses Are Required for Paving Installation?
Typically, paving installation necessitates permits such as municipal building permits, zoning clearances, and environmental assessments. Rules vary by location, so contacting local authorities guarantees adherence with required legal standards for the undertaking.
Is Paving Feasible During Winter or Precipitation-Heavy Periods?
Paving can be difficult during winter or rainy seasons due to thermal fluctuations and dampness. Cold weather can disrupt proper curing, while excessive rain may cause finishing defects, leading to potential long-term damage. Careful planning is indispensable.
How Should I Respond if My Pavement Starts Cracking?
If pavement develops fractures, the initial action is to assess the harm. Next in line, clean the region completely, seal the cracks with suitable filler, and consider professional repair to prevent further deterioration and maintain safety.
What ways can I use to determine whether my pavement specialist is properly licensed?
To determine if a paving contractor is licensed, one should check credentials with local licensing authorities, request a copy of their license, and verify insurance protection, ensuring compliance with industry regulations and safety standards.
